Negev, 4th century BCE. Ceramic Vessel. Commodity chit.
Body sherd of persian-period closed vessel, exterior pinkish white with few white grits. Written on uneven surface.

[...]Q[o]sḥanan:
[...]m(aah), 1; q(uarter), 1.
Reconstruction of this text is very difficult. Qosḥanan might be the payee, with the name of the payer coming at the beginning of line 1, but the name only appears once as a payee elsewhere (A51.3).
